--- Comment #1 from Gert Doering <gert at greenie.muc.de> ---
the amanda-client-3.3.9,1 bin package is compiled to require
/usr/local/etc/amanda/security.conf but does not install it(!) - so, after an
upgrade of a client-only (no amanda-server installed), all backups fail.
